zoukankan      html  css  js  c++  java
  • K8S(一)——集群部署

    声明:安装来自视频https://www.bilibili.com/video/BV1PJ411h7Sw?p=13

    一、集群规划如图:

    所用机器:CentOS7 minial,所有机器均为网卡nat模式

    一、安装epel源,关闭防火墙和selinux

    wget -O /etc/yum.repos.d/epel.repo http://mirrors.aliyun.com/repo/epel-7.repo

    二、安装必要工具

    yum install wget net-tools telnet tree nmap sysstat lrzsz dos2unix bind-utils -y

    三、DNS初始化

    1.在10.4.7.11主机安装

    yum install -y bind
    

     2.配置DNS

    主配置文件
    vim /etc/named.conf // 修改 listen-on port 53 { 10.4.7.11; }; // listen-on-v6 port 53 { ::1; }; allow-query { any; }; forwarders { 10.4.7.254; }; // 上级DNS,此处指向网关 dnssec-enable no; dnssec-validation no;
    配置区域文件 vim /etc/named.rfc1912.zones // 添加
      zone "host.com" IN {    type master;     file "host.com.zone";     allow-update { 10.4.7.11; };   };   zone "xyly.com" IN { type master; file "xyly.com.zone"; allow-update { 10.4.7.11; }; };
    配置数据文件 cp -a /var/named/named.localhost /var/named/host.com.zone
    vim /var/named/host.com.zone
      $TTL 600        ; 10 minutes
      @       IN SOA  dns.host.com. dnsadmin.host.com. (
                                              2020051400      ; serial
                                              1D              ; refresh
                                              1H              ; retry
                                              1W              ; expire
                                              3H )            ; minimum
              NS      dns.host.com.
      $TTL 60 ; 1 minute
      dns     A       10.4.7.11
      SX7-11  A       10.4.7.11
      SX7-12  A       10.4.7.12
      SX7-21  A       10.4.7.21
      SX7-22  A       10.4.7.22
      SX7-200 A       10.4.7.200
    cp -a /var/named/named.localhost /var/named/xyly.com.zone
    vim /var/named/xyly.com.zone
      $ORIGIN xyly.com.
      $TTL 600        ; 10 minutes
      @       IN SOA  dns.xyly.com.  dnsadmin.xyly.com. (
                                            2020051401      ; serial
                                            1D              ; refresh
                                            1H              ; retry
                                            1W              ; expire
                                            3H )            ; minimum
              NS      dns.xyly.com.
      $TTL 60 ; 1 minute
      dns     A       10.4.7.11

    启动服务
     systemctl start named

     3.测试DNS

    dig -t A sx7-12.host.com @10.4.7.11 +short

    4.配置DNS客户端(所有机器均需修改)

    sed -i '/^DNS/s/254/11/'  /etc/sysconfig/network-scripts/ifcfg-ens32
    systemctl restart network
    sed -i '1asearch host.com ' /etc/resolv.conf

    测试结果
  • 相关阅读:
    简单的冒泡排序算法(java)
    寻找两个数组中的公共元素Java程序代码
    利用快速排序求两集合交集
    一种简单的吉布斯采样modify中应用
    递归生成小于某个数的所有集合
    卡拉曼算法简答程序
    模态对话框退出DoModal过程中需注意的陷阱
    是否可以使用空对象指针调用成员函数及访问成员变量
    windows c++如何使窗口动态改变位置
    windows的滚动条使用
  • 原文地址:https://www.cnblogs.com/xyly/p/12891840.html
Copyright © 2011-2022 走看看